A long-standing protection for taxpayers is in danger.

The federal Hyde Amendment, which has barred taxpayer funding of abortion except in limited cases, is in jeopardy. This time-tested policy safeguards hard-earned taxpayer dollars, while also saving lives that would be otherwise lost to abortion.

It’s time for us to speak to our congressional representatives and U.S. senators and let them know that no budget should be approved unless it contains Hyde Amendment protections for taxpayers, unborn babies and their mothers.

Maria V. Gallagher

Harrisburg

The writer is legislative director of the Pennsylvania Pro-Life Federation.
